Le Malesherbois is a commune located in the Loiret department of north-central France, offering diverse landscapes for outdoor activities. Situated at the confluence of the Essonne and Seine-et-Marne departments, it forms part of the Grand Pithiverais region, blending the plains of Beauce, the Forêt d'Orléans, the Essonne valley, and the bocage of the Gâtinais. This varied terrain provides opportunities for several sports like road cycling, hiking, mountain biking, touring cycling, and more.

Le Malesherbois offers 12 hiking routes, ranging from easy strolls along the Essonne river to more challenging paths within the nearby Gâtinais Français Regional Natural Park. Trails explore dense woods, wetlands, and diverse forest landscapes. The Hiking around Le Malesherbois guide provides further information.
Le Malesherbois features 10 mountain biking trails, utilizing the varied terrain of the surrounding areas. The Gâtinais Français Regional Natural Park offers ample opportunities for mountain biking. The MTB Trails around Le Malesherbois guide details specific routes.
There are 26 touring cycling routes in Le Malesherbois, benefiting from established cycling infrastructure and proximity to major touring routes like the "Loire à Vélo" and "Scandibérique." These paths are suitable for long-distance, signposted tours. The Cycling around Le Malesherbois guide offers more details.
Yes, the region's gentle elevation changes, particularly along the Essonne river and in parts of the Gâtinais, make many trails accessible for various skill levels and families. Routes are available for hiking, cycling, and jogging that cater to beginners and those seeking less strenuous options.
Trails in Le Malesherbois traverse diverse natural features including the Essonne river, wetlands like the Marais du Moulin de la Porte, and the expansive Forêt d'Orléans. The nearby Gâtinais Français Regional Natural Park offers a mosaic of forests, open fields, and plateaus.

The Forêt d'Orléans, one of France's largest national forests, is accessible from Le Malesherbois and offers diverse ecosystems for exploration. Numerous marked trails are available for hiking, cycling, and mountain biking, allowing visitors to discover ancient trees, ponds, and rich biodiversity.
